Was using the backhoe to bucket limestone in driveway when the clutch adjusting rod broke. I thought this to be an odd failure. It has broken so that the break is inside the clutch housing. Has anyone else ever ran into this type of failure before. Is there any other fix known other than splitting tractor? thank-you Don
 
There is an access plate on the side of the housing,take it off and have a look inside,if its the rod that broke you can change it but it is usually the yoke for the throwout bearing that breaks,its possible to replace that by removing the cross shaft if there is enough room to get it out.
